Detalles del Curso

โ€ข Introduction to AI-Driven Biofabrication Technologies: Fundamentals of artificial intelligence, machine learning, and biofabrication; exploring the intersection of these technologies.
โ€ข AI in Bioprinting: Overview of AI applications in bioprinting; predictive modeling, automated design, and quality control.
โ€ข Machine Learning Algorithms in Biofabrication: Deep dive into various ML algorithms suitable for biofabrication, such as regression, clustering, and neural networks.
โ€ข Biofabrication Data Management: Data curation, storage, and sharing in biofabrication; ethical considerations and best practices.
โ€ข AI-Driven Design for Biofabrication: Generative design, topology optimization, and lattice structures for AI-driven biofabrication.
โ€ข Advanced Biofabrication Techniques: Emerging AI-driven biofabrication technologies and techniques, such as 4D biofabrication and organ-on-chip.
โ€ข Biocompatibility and Safety Considerations: Ensuring biocompatibility and safety in AI-driven biofabrication; regulatory compliance and quality standards.
โ€ข Industry Trends and Future Perspectives: Overview of current market trends, future developments, and potential applications of AI-driven biofabrication technologies.
